          This buck showed up on the chopper survey. From the chopper he didn't look that great to them. My brother was going to find him and hunt him if he was old enough...and not too big. My 12 hung out in the same area. We had no history of either deer, but they lived in an area where very few hunt. We call it the squiggly road. It's curvey and doesn't have areas where rifle hunters can see long distances.

          I had him come in while I was hunting my 12 in mid October. He was between 70 and 100 yards. I didn't pay a lot of attention to the body because the rack was so impressive. WIDE. When I went in, I told my brother it was good he didn't spend a lot of time looking for this deer. He said "not that good?". I said, "no, way too good". Then I showed the video. Got "oh my God's" a lot. Asked, I said I thought he was 5 1/2, but no more.

          That was the last, and only, time he was seen, until I found the hangout of my 12 on the Squiggly Road. Seemed Cluster (what we call him) hung in the same area. I set up my blind and he and I began a three month association. I have hours of time with him in front of me at severely close bow range. Nothing about the deer indicated any older than 5 1/2. His head, manners, and general body confirmation, even though he's long and tall, tell me he's more likely 4 1/2. When asked, since I'm the only one that has seen him other than two other long range sightings, I said I believed he was 4 1/2. We shoed the video to the other members and almost unanimously, he was considered 4 1/2. We'll treat him as a 4 1/2, with an option to change our mind depending on what he does next year. He'll probably get two years.

                      This one is a little tricky....I can see 4.5 peak rut, 5.5 post rut.

                      The only catch is his hind qtrs. They appear very pointed to his tail (no roundness to the ham) - I typically only see this on 7+ yr old deer.

                      Couple questions...

                      1. Do you know this deer?
                      2. When were the pic's taken?
                      3. Does he have defined caluses on his knees? Indicator of a solid 6.5+ year old deer.
